import os
from typing import Literal
from dataclasses import dataclass
import datetime
import psycopg2
BASE_URL = os.environ["BASE_URL"]
class DbContextManager:
def __init__(self, db: "Db"):
self.db = db
def __enter__(self):
self.cursor = self.db.get_cursor()
return (self.db.conn, self.cursor)
def __exit__(self, exc_type, exc_val, exc_tb):
if self.cursor:
self.cursor.close()
# Return False to propagate exceptions, True to suppress them
return False
class Db:
MAX_RETRIES = 5
def __init__(self):
self.connect()
def connect(self):
self.conn = psycopg2.connect(
host=os.getenv('DB_HOST', 'localhost'),
database=os.getenv('DB_DATABASE', 'postgres'),
port=os.getenv('DB_PORT', '5432'),
user=os.getenv('DB_USER', 'postgres'),
password=os.environ['DB_PASSWORD'])
def get_cursor(self):
for _ in range(self.MAX_RETRIES):
try:
return self.conn.cursor()
except psycopg2.OperationalError:
self.connect()
raise Exception(f"Failed to connect to database after {Db.MAX_RETRIES} retries.")
def cursor(self):
return DbContextManager(db=self)
db = Db()
@dataclass
class Vote:
id: str
poll_id: str
choice_id: str
voter_name: str
value: int # 0 or 1
@dataclass
class Choice:
id: str
poll_id: str
start_datetime: datetime.datetime
end_datetime: datetime.datetime
votes: list[Vote]
def start_datetime_notz(self):
return self.start_datetime.replace(tzinfo=None)
def end_datetime_notz(self):
return self.end_datetime.replace(tzinfo=None)
def start_date_notz(self):
return self.start_datetime.date()
def end_date_notz(self):
return self.end_datetime.date()
def ends_on_same_day(self):
return self.start_datetime.date() == self.end_datetime.date()
def ends_at_same_datetime(self):
return self.start_datetime.date() == self.end_datetime.date() \
and self.start_datetime.time() == self.end_datetime.time()
def votes_with_value(self, value: int) -> list[Vote]:
return [vote for vote in self.votes if vote.value == value]
@dataclass
class Poll:
id: str
title: str
description: str | None
pub_date: datetime.datetime
author_name: str
author_email: str | None
choices: list[Choice]
manage_code: str
is_whole_day: bool
def pub_date_formatted_notz(self):
date = self.pub_date.replace(tzinfo = None).strftime("%d.%m.%Y")
time = self.pub_date.replace(tzinfo = None).strftime("%H:%M")
return f"Created on {date} at {time}"
def share_url(self):
return f"{BASE_URL}/poll/{self.id}"
def manage_url(self):
return f"{BASE_URL}/manage/{self.manage_code}"
def tuple_to_poll(poll_t: tuple) -> Poll:
return Poll(
id=poll_t[0],
title=poll_t[1],
description=poll_t[2],
pub_date=poll_t[3],
author_name=poll_t[4],
author_email=poll_t[5],
manage_code=poll_t[6],
is_whole_day=poll_t[7],
choices=[]
)
def tuple_to_choice(choice_t: tuple) -> Choice:
return Choice(
id=choice_t[0],
poll_id=choice_t[1],
start_datetime=choice_t[2],
end_datetime=choice_t[3],
votes=[]
)
def tuple_to_vote(vote_t: tuple) -> Vote:
return Vote(
id=vote_t[0],
poll_id=vote_t[1],
choice_id=vote_t[2],
voter_name=vote_t[3],
value=vote_t[4],
)
def get_poll(id: str):
with db.cursor() as (conn, cur):
try:
cur.execute("SELECT * FROM polls WHERE id = %s", (id,))
poll_t = cur.fetchone()
if poll_t is None:
return None
poll = tuple_to_poll(poll_t)
cur.execute("SELECT * FROM choices "
"WHERE poll_id = %s "
"ORDER BY start_datetime", (id,))
choice_ts = cur.fetchall()
cur.execute("SELECT * FROM votes "
"WHERE poll_id = %s "
"ORDER BY voter_name", (id,))
vote_ts = cur.fetchall()
for choice_t in choice_ts:
choice = tuple_to_choice(choice_t)
for vote_t in vote_ts:
vote = tuple_to_vote(vote_t)
if vote.choice_id == choice.id:
choice.votes.append(vote)
poll.choices.append(choice)
conn.commit()
return poll
except Exception as e:
conn.rollback()
raise e
def create_poll(title: str,
description: str,
author_name: str,
author_email: str,
is_whole_day: bool,
choices: list[Choice]):
with db.cursor() as (conn, cur):
try:
cur.execute("INSERT INTO polls (title, description, author_name, author_email, whole_day)"
"VALUES (%s, %s, %s, %s, %s) RETURNING *",
(title, description, author_name, author_email, is_whole_day))
poll_t = cur.fetchone()
if poll_t is None:
raise Exception("Failed to create poll")
poll = tuple_to_poll(poll_t)
for choice in choices:
cur.execute("INSERT INTO choices (poll_id, start_datetime, end_datetime)"
"VALUES (%s, %s, %s)",
(poll.id, choice.start_datetime, choice.end_datetime))
conn.commit()
return poll
except Exception as e:
conn.rollback()
raise e
def vote_poll(poll_id: str, voter_name: str, selections: dict[str, int]) -> None:
with db.cursor() as (conn, cur):
try:
for choice_id in selections:
value = selections[choice_id]
cur.execute("INSERT INTO votes (poll_id, voter_name, choice_id, value)"
"VALUES (%s, %s, %s, %s)",
(poll_id, voter_name, choice_id, value))
conn.commit()
except Exception as e:
conn.rollback()
raise e
def apply_migration(migration_sql: str) -> None:
with db.cursor() as (conn, cur):
try:
cur.execute(migration_sql)
conn.commit()
except Exception as e:
conn.rollback()
raise e
def get_poll_by_code(code: str) -> Poll | None:
with db.cursor() as (conn, cur):
try:
cur.execute("SELECT id FROM polls WHERE manage_code = %s", (code,))
poll_t = cur.fetchone()
if poll_t is None:
return None
poll = get_poll(poll_t[0])
conn.commit()
return poll
except Exception as e:
conn.rollback()
raise e
def update_poll_info(
code,
title,
description,
author_name,
author_email,
is_whole_day,
) -> str | None:
"""Returns the id of the updated poll or None if not found."""
with db.cursor() as (conn, cur):
try:
cur.execute("UPDATE polls SET title = %s, description = %s, author_name = %s, author_email = %s, whole_day = %s "
"WHERE manage_code = %s "
"RETURNING id",
(title, description, author_name, author_email, is_whole_day, code))
changed = cur.fetchone()
conn.commit()
return changed[0] if changed else None
except Exception as e:
conn.rollback()
raise e
def add_choice_to_poll(
code,
start_datetime,
end_datetime,
) -> None:
poll = get_poll_by_code(code)
if poll is None:
raise Exception(f"Poll not found for code: {code}")
with db.cursor() as (conn, cur):
try:
cur.execute("INSERT INTO choices (poll_id, start_datetime, end_datetime)"
"VALUES (%s, %s, %s) "
"RETURNING id",
(poll.id, start_datetime, end_datetime))
conn.commit()
except Exception as e:
conn.rollback()
raise e
def delete_choice(choice_id: str) -> None:
with db.cursor() as (conn, cur):
try:
cur.execute("DELETE FROM choices WHERE id = %s", (choice_id,))
cur.execute("DELETE FROM votes WHERE choice_id = %s", (choice_id,))
conn.commit()
except Exception as e:
conn.rollback()
raise e
def get_polls_by_codes(codes: list[str]) -> list[Poll]:
with db.cursor() as (conn, cur):
try:
codes_t = tuple(codes)
cur.execute("SELECT * FROM polls WHERE manage_code IN %s"
"ORDER BY pub_date DESC", (codes_t,))
poll_ts = cur.fetchall()
polls = [tuple_to_poll(poll_t) for poll_t in poll_ts]
conn.commit()
return polls
except Exception as e:
conn.rollback()
raise e
def delete_poll(code: str) -> None:
with db.cursor() as (conn, cur):
try:
cur.execute("DELETE FROM polls WHERE manage_code = %s", (code,))
conn.commit()
except Exception as e:
conn.rollback()
raise e
